Then down to work. Checking the schedule of containers to be loaded. See how they are getting on with packing delivered products. Here in Bali the artisans don't do packing. We take deliveries of "finished products" off the back of trucks or in big bamboo baskets. The quality control, barcoding, wrapping and packing in boxes and cartons ready for export is all done in our warehouse. The empty container turns up and all the packing staff become container packers loading the container, usually in the evening because cooler to work.
